














UPGRADING
Please import your old FoxyProxy settings using the Import button!
Firefox 57+ is significantly different than previous Firefox versions. I was forced to re-write 10 years of mature FoxyProxy code from scratch. There are many missing features, and in almost all cases that is due to Firefox 57+ limitations or bugs (for example, custom-colored toolbar icons). The UI also had to change; I could no longer make FoxyProxy look like a native application. It now looks more like a traditional web site.
I understand your frustration. Please refrain from attacking me because there is nothing I can do to change Mozilla's decisions. Thank you for using my labor of love.

PERMISSIONS
The "Download files" permission is used to export FoxyProxy settings to a file (so you can import it elsewhere). The "Download history" permission is required only because Firefox does not allow add-ons to specify just "download files" without "download history". It's all or nothing. Internally, nothing is done with your download history. This is open source software and you can view the code yourself at https://code.getfoxyproxy.org
WHAT IS IT?
FoxyProxy is a Firefox extension which automatically switches an internet connection across one or more proxy servers based on URL patterns. Put simply, FoxyProxy automates the manual process of editing Firefox's Connection Settings dialog. Proxy server switching occurs based on the loading URL and the switching rules you define.

- Switch proxies with URL pattern matching
- Custom colors make it easy to see which proxy is in use
- Advanced logging shows you which proxies were used and when
- Automatically synchronize all of your proxy settings with your other Firefox instances when you use Firefox Sync. Import/Export settings to files when not using Firefox Sync
